ISOPE-2005 Seoul Conference, June 19-24

 

The 15th International Offshore and Polar Engineering Conference & Exhibition (ISOPE-2005) will be held at COEX Convention Center, Seoul, Korea, June 19-24, 2005 with 91 sessions. All technical sessions take place at COEX Convention Center (www.coex.co.kr), and Reception and Banquet at COEX Intercontinental Seoul Hotel.
